Microwave Shrimp Pasta Primavera Recipe

Yield: 8 Servings
Recipe by luhu.jp

Ingredients:
8 ounce: Medium Shells OR Mostaccioli OR other medium pasta shape, uncooked
13 3/4 ounce: Low-sodium chicken broth,
3 tbsp: Cornstarch,
2 tbsp: Vegetable oil,
1 large: Onion, cut in thin wedges
3 large: Garlic cloves, minced
2 medium: Carrots, cut in matchstick-size pieces
1 medium: Red bell pepper, seeded, cut in thin strips
1/2 cup: Snow peas cut in half diagonally,
2 tbsp: Lemon juice,
1 tbsp: Grated fresh ginger,
1/8 tsp: Crushed red pepper, optional
12 ounce: Medium shrimp, shelled and deveined

Directions:
Prepare pasta according to package directions. While pasta is
cooking, stir together chicken broth and cornstarch in a small bowl.
In a 2-quart, microwaveable casserole or bowl, combine vegetable oil,
onion, garlic, carrots, red pepper, snow peas, lemon juice, ginger
and crushed red pepper. Cover; microwave on HIGH (100 percent)
stirring once, for 3 minutes or until vegetables are tender-crisp.
Restir cornstarch mixture. Stir into vegetables. Cover; microwave
stirring once, for 5 minutes or until slightly thickened. Add shrimp.
Cover; microwave on HIGH for 2 minutes, stirring once. Let stand 2
minutes.

When pasta is done, drain well. Spoon shrimp mixture over pasta, toss
and serve.

Each serving provides: 314 Calories; 16.7 g Protein; 48.8 g
Carbohydrates; 5.4 g Fat; 65.2 mg Cholesterol; 209 mg Sodium.
Calories from Fat: 16%
